The meaning of . ODT abbreviation is Open Document Text . ODT is part of the Open Document Format (ODF), which was created to store data for OpenOffice systems.

OpenDocument (. odt) files are compatible with Word and open source applications like OpenOffice and LibreOffice, but you might see formatting differences and some Word features arent available in . odt files. Word documents (. docx) are compatible with most applications.
The . odt file extension is associated with an OpenDocument text document, created by LibreOffice Writer, OpenOffice Writer, or another word processor.
You can open and save files in the OpenDocument Text (. odt) file format used by some word processing applications.
Use Word to open or save a document in the OpenDocument Text (. odt) format Click the File tab. Click Open. Click Browse, To see only the files saved in the OpenDocument format, click the list of file types next to the File name box, and then click OpenDocument Text. Click the file you want to open, and then click Open.
